The Online Mystery Box Trend

Mystery boxes add excitement to online shopping. These carefully curated packages offer an array of items at a price lower than their retail value. This creates an engaging experience for the consumer.

They appeal to the consumer's desire to own rare or valuable items. This allows them to feel the thrill of the unknowable while also increasing brand loyalty. There are some concerns with mystery boxes that have to be carefully considered.

The popularity of the mystery box concept has led to an increase in the number of companies providing customized boxes to their customers. For instance, Stitch Fix and Trunk Club let customers take a style assessment and then receive items of clothing specifically designed to suit their preferences. These brands have gained an enduring following due to their individual approach.

Another recent development is the appearance of eco-friendly mystery boxes. These boxes are usually made out of recycled materials and are products that are environmentally friendly. This trend is expected to continue to grow as environmental awareness is growing.

The proliferation of verifiably fair verification systems has been one of the most significant changes in the business of mystery boxes. These mechanisms ensure that the contents of the mystery box are based on chance and not rigged by unscrupulous retailers. This is a significant advancement that has enabled the popularity of mystery boxes to to increase.

Personalized mysteries are another trend that is predicted to continue to gain popularity. Subscription boxes, such as Stitch Fix or Trunk Club, for example provide customers with clothing that is tailored to their personal preferences in style. This allows them build relationships with customers and to increase loyalty.
